The scarab scene is very short. It starts when you turn a corner and stop hard, and ends a few seconds later when the room goes dark.
 
Idon't know anyone who has "actually" been scared by the scarabs. Most people go "ooo" and "ahhh." The only thing that gets them is the water that drops there....occasionally....and the sudden backwards drop that isn't bad at all.
 
If you don't like bugs, you won't like the scarab scene. Just ask flyfly. :rolleyes1
